Day 1 Teaching @ the HUB School in Serbia

Last night we took an overnight train from Budapest, Hungary to Belgrade, Serbia. We had sleeper cars on the train that were fairly comfortable (or maybe we were just super tried). We had to be woken up at the Serbian border to do passport checks.

Today (Monday) was our first day of teaching at the HUB School (www.hub.org.rs) just outside of Belgrade, Serbia. We arrived at 8 am, ate a quick Serbian breakfast, and started teaching a 9:15 am. We are teaching 24 very engaged students. These students come from Serbia, Macedonia, Slovakia, Bosnia, Kosovo, Hungary, and Croatia. While most of the students are in their 20s some are nearly 60. Several of the students speak some English which has been very helpful. We spent the morning teaching the principles of disciple-making and the afternoon teaching the Bible Overview.
